My guess is it's based on how you file. If you file jointly and as a couple make more than $150K you get nothing.

Aleta is right. You must have earned at least $3,000 as a single (or as a couple if filing jointly) to earn the rebate for your household. If you've just been drawing social security or welfare, you're probably going to get nothing.

But we won't know for sure on any of this until the law officially passes.
